Posted by: majidekeitai

Well I just got my 703SHf yesterday and I am having no issues at all in the SF area. I'm on Cingular though. After spending a few days on these boards I think I can help you answer some of your questions but I recommend searching for yourself as well:

1 - Reprovisioning. Seems like there is no issue with the new firmware except for the Japanese one. Not much of an issue though as it's only one more click. I thought Timsta had a full unlock but one of his new posts seemed like he hasn't really got into the 703SHf so I think the 703SH has this problem solved but not hte 703SHf. Another thread mentioned somthing about flashing the 703SH firmware onto the 703SHf which will get rid of the reprovisioning problem.

2 - Never heard about a problem with the voicemail icon. I just set the VM# to speed dial, no need to go into the menu and click an icon.

3 - You will have to edit your phone book and add an entry I believe if you stored them on your SIM as the Japanese will sort by 'Reading' format. You will have to add the name into the 'Reading' field for each number so it will sort properly. If you stored them on the phone, I don't think there is a way to transfer them.

Hope this helps you a little. All the information I found on this forum so try taking a look around. There's alot of information out there.

Posted by: Kevbodian

im sure that if the phone was on when you dropped it, it is toast or something haha.

about repro, it can be removed. there are 2 ways. both require flashing; 1 of the ways, the better way, requires sending to Tim to do. the other way also works but you cannot do master reset and you must send your phone AND SIM to one of us.

answering machine is possible on Euro firmware as well as Japanese.

and ur phonebook must be re-entered in the READING field of each contact.
